0 Emissions 8–25 kW PowerIn the OutBoard family, our NS-OUT-08, NS-OUT-12, NS-OUT-16, NS-OUT-20, and NS-OUT-25 models offer a wide range of power options. Each model is specifically developed to deliver reliable performance under challenging marine conditions.
| Product Code | Power (kW) | Operating Voltage (V) | Equivalent Power (HP) | Maximum Torque (Nm) | Weight (Kg) | Details |
|---|---|---|---|---|---|---|
| 8 kW | 87.6 V | 50-70 HP | 104 Nm | 82 Kg | Learn More | |
| 12 kW | 87.6 V | 75-100 HP | 126 Nm | 103 Kg | Learn More | |
| 16 kW | 87.6 – 102.2 V | 95-120 HP | 158 Nm | 117 Kg | Learn More | |
| 20 kW | 87.6 – 102.2 V | 130-170 HP | 243 Nm | — | Learn More | |
| 25 kW | 87.6 – 102.2 V | 180-230 HP | 331 Nm | — | Learn More |
